  2. I spent about 8 months preparing for my cruise. I made a list of things I could have and things they should not use for the CHEF to follow. I talked with the cruise line HEADQUARTERS (and made note of the date and name of staff member I talked to) and got permission to bring my own toaster for them to use as well as my own gluten free bread.
